Located one mile from Inverness and near the Point Reyes National Seashore, Marsh Cottage has been a favorite retreat since 1985 for those who prefer the comforts of a bed and breakfast in the privacy of their own completely equipped cottage. Only one party of two (or three - and, children are welcome) can occupy Marsh Cottage at one time; there are not other units.
The cottage sits on a salt/freshwater marsh along Tomales Bay- local wildlife and flora create a unique and magical setting that enhances guests' experience of the Point Reyes area in all its seasons. It has a full kitchen, bath, queen bed, desk and sitting area, fireplace, guidebooks, daypacks, board games, even binoculars. Breakfast is provided in the privacy of the cottage, and consists of fresh orange juice, fresh-baked muffins or breakfast bread, fresh fruits in season, milk and granola cereals, a basket of eggs, and a generous assortment of teas, and regular and decaf french roast coffee. Many make it a ritual to take breakfast out on the sunny deck overlooking the bay and Black Mountain.
Originally built in the 30's, its style is that of a nostalgic Cape Cod country cottage--with grey wood exterior, white trim, remodeled white wood interior, mullioned (small paned) windows, colors of teal, white, beige, terracotta, coordinated print fabrics, functional antiques, front porch and deck with weathered redwood furniture.
